
Helen Flanagan has shared a further personal update after posting an emotional video on Monday about her struggles with co-parenting and being away from her children. The mum of three broke down on Instagram as she explained that her anxiety was bad recently and she was feeling overwhelmed.
The former Coronation Street star shares three children with her ex-partner, Scott Sinclair. They have two daughters together, nine-year-old Matilda, six-year-old Delilah and son Charlie who is three years old. Helen separated from the footballer in 2022 after 13 years together and getting engaged.
In the tearful video, she admitted she thinks the time away from her children will allow her to be more “clear-headed” when they return. She continued this sentiment in a more upbeat video shared yesterday.
The actress told Instagram followers that she relies on social media to make connections with others, saying: “I feel like I have been sharing my life on social media for such a long time and I do actually put my life on, I don’t sugar-coat anything and I do keep it real.
“I do like to connect with other women and thank you so much for your lovely messages and it made me feel like I wasn’t on my own.”
Opening up about the emotions she has shown recently, she added: “I don’t usually like to cry but I do like to share my real life on here and actually be myself.
“After crying, I’ve actually got a really working week – this is the thing with my ADHD, when I look at my working week I realise I actually needed the childcare.

“I am on a really big shoot today for something really exciting, really exciting. That’s today which I am buzzing about. For me, especially with the kids when the kids are away, my work just saves me, my work is like my everything. I need my work, I need that focus.”
The Rosie Webster actress continued: “This is my ADHD brain, I really needed the childcare actually.” Helen has been open her fears concerning what her children will think of her when she is older.
She told followers: “I don’t want my kids looking back and thinking ‘mummy was always stressed, mummy was shouting’ because actually, mummy really loves you but mum just feels she’s spinning loads of plates”, and admitted “with having ADHD I really struggle to regulate my emotions.”
The mum of three recently split from ex-footballer Robbie Talbot. Robbie, who used to play for Marine FC had a relationship with Helen during and after her stint on the E4 reality show, Celebs Go Dating, which was broadcast last year.
She has also appeared on I’m A Celebrity South Africa in 2023 and Celebs Go Dating in 2024, but is most known for being a part of the Webster family on Coronation Street.
She played the role of Rosie Webster on the Cobbles from 2000 to 2012 and from 2017 to 2018. After going on maternity leave in 2018, she did not return to the role.
